Abstract

Interview conducted with Professor Sebastião Pimentel Franco, a prominent researcher in the history of health and disease in Brazil. The historian discusses his entry into this field during his postdoctoral studies, when he investigated the cholera epidemic in Espírito Santo. He highlights the importance of graduate programs and the Brazilian National History Association (ANPUH) in expanding and regionalizing research in this area. He also presents the trajectory of the Colloquium on the History of Diseases, held annually at the Federal University of Espírito Santo, as well as the challenges of funding the event. Finally, he discusses the “Histórias nas Redes” project, a successful public history initiative that promoted online broadcasts and resulted in the publication of books on different historical topics.
